My RRM header had the chrome get a little duller. It is no big deal. Just look for cracks and make sure that all the flanges have no holes. If it is the header from RRM, it is compadible with their turbo kit, but I am unsure of other brands of headers such as RMR, kamakaze, etc.. It should work fine. Just get new gaskets to make sure you don't have any leaks.
